Hydro sample from my first saison! Used Wyeast French Saison, expected it to get a little lower(esp given 1.036 OG) but it did stay in the low 60s.

From the sample, wow super refreshing! Nice bouquet of saison character mingling with floral English hops(I forget what they were though, changed my mind at the last minute). Nice spicy saison up front with just a hint of bitter orange that emerges after the swallow. I assume low on the fruitiness due to lower temps. Extremely light body and I'm going to carb this up as high as I feel comfortable in my SN stubbies.

Thinking of setting aside a gallon to pour some WW, JK, or Allagash dregs into.
